Essential Skincare Routine for a Natural Glow

An essential skincare routine for naturally glowy skin starts with simplicity and consistency, perfect for mothers craving radiance without the hassle. Begin with a gentle cleanser to sweep away impurities, followed by a lightweight exfoliant—like a chemical exfoliant with AHAs or a mild scrub—used once or twice a week to reveal fresh, bright skin.

Next, hydrate with a toner or essence rich in humectants like hyaluronic acid, then add in a hydrating serum and finally lock it in with a nourishing moisturizer that suits your skin type—think lightweight for oily skin or creamy for dry.

Finish with a daily broad-spectrum SPF to protect your glow from UV damage, and if time allows, a weekly hydrating mask can boost that lit-from-within look. Stick to this streamlined routine, and your skin will radiate health and vitality with no makeup required.

Bonus Steps for Extra Glow

  • Face Oils – A few drops of nourishing face oil (like rosehip or jojoba) can add an extra boost of radiance, especially at night.
  • Sheet Masks – Hydrating masks packed with hyaluronic acid or green tea extract give your skin an instant plump and glow.
  • Healthy Diet & Hydration – Skincare starts from within. Drink plenty of water and load up on antioxidants (berries, leafy greens, nuts) to keep your skin glowing naturally.

Choosing the Right Primer for a Luminous Finish

Choosing the right primer for a luminous finish is all about finding a formula that enhances your skin’s natural radiance while preparing it for makeup that lasts through your busiest days. Look for primers with light-reflecting particles or a subtle shimmer—ingredients like mica or pearl extract can give that instant glow without feeling heavy.

Glowy Makeup

If your skin tends to be dry, opt for a hydrating primer packed with hyaluronic acid or glycerin to plump and brighten your skin, creating a dewy canvas; for oily skin, choose a lightweight, silicone-based option with a radiant finish to control shine without dulling your glow. 

Pro Tip: Consider your undertone too—peachy or golden-toned primers brighten warm skin, while pink or pearlescent ones lift cooler complexions. Test a small amount to ensure it blends seamlessly with your foundation, and you’ll have a luminous base that keeps you glowing, whether you’re running errands or stealing a rare moment for yourself.

Finding the Perfect Foundation and Concealer for a Dewy Complexion

Finding the perfect foundation and concealer for a dewy complexion means prioritizing lightweight, hydrating formulas that enhance your skin’s natural radiance rather than masking it. For foundation, look for options like Giorgio Armani Luminous Silk Foundation or IT Cosmetics Your Skin But Better CC+ Cream, which offer buildable coverage with a silky, glowing finish—ideal for a fresh, hydrated look.

Seek out products infused with moisturizing ingredients like hyaluronic acid or light-reflecting particles to boost that flawless effect, and match your shade closely to avoid a flat appearance.

For concealer, go for creamy, luminous picks like NARS Radiant Creamy Concealer or Maybelline Instant Age Rewind, which blend seamlessly to brighten under-eyes or cover spots without caking. Test them in natural light, apply sparingly with a damp sponge or fingertips, and skip heavy setting powders—let your skin’s texture shine through for that effortlessly polished glow.

Pro Tips for the Ultimate Makeup Wear Finish

  • Prep your skin with a hydrating primer or lightweight moisturizer to create a smooth base.
  • Apply foundation sparingly—a little goes a long way, and sheer layers give the most natural effect.
  • Use a damp sponge for seamless blending and extra hydration.
  • Set strategically with a fine, luminous setting powder (only where needed) to keep the glow intact without excess shine.
  • Mist with a setting spray for the final touch of radiance and to lock everything in place.

Using Highlighter and Blush for Added Natural Radiance

Using highlighter and blush strategically can elevate your natural radiance, creating that lit-from-within glow. For highlighter, choose a creamy or liquid formula like Becca Shimmering Skin Perfector or Tower 28 SuperDew Highlighter—opt for shades like champagne or soft gold for warm tones or pearly pink for cooler ones—and dab it lightly onto the high points of your face (cheekbones, brow bones, and the bridge of your nose) with your fingertips or a small brush for a seamless sheen.

With blush, go for a dewy finish with cream or liquid options like ILIA Multi-Stick or Merit Flush Balm in peachy or rosy hues; apply it to the apples of your cheeks and blend upward toward your temples for a healthy, flushed look. Layer sparingly, blending well to mimic a natural flush, and you’ll add dimension and warmth that will enhance your glow without overpowering your natural beauty.

Importance of Bronzer in Your Face Makeup Routine

Bronzer plays a vital role in your face makeup routine by adding warmth, dimension, and a sun-kissed glow that can elevate even the simplest look. Unlike foundation or concealer, which focuses on evening out your complexion, bronzer mimics the natural effects of sun exposure, subtly sculpting your features and bringing life to your skin—especially on days when you’re feeling washed out.

Applied lightly to areas where the sun naturally hits, like your forehead, cheekbones, and jawline, it creates a healthy, radiant finish that pairs beautifully with a glowy makeup style. Opt for a creamy or powder formula with a satin or subtle shimmer finish, such as Too Faced Chocolate Soleil Bronzer or Milk Makeup Matte Bronzer, to keep it natural and blendable.

Simple Step-by-Step Glowy Makeup Tutorial

Here’s a simple step-by-step glowy makeup tutorial for moms for an effortless, radiant look. 

  • Step 1: Start with clean, hydrated skin—wash with a gentle cleanser, apply a lightweight moisturizer, and smooth on a hydrating primer like e.l.f. Luminous Putty Primer
  • Step 2: Even out your complexion with a dewy foundation or tinted moisturizer (try Maybelline Fit Me Dewy + Smooth), using a damp makeup sponge for a natural finish or your fingertips. 
  • Step 3: Dab a creamy concealer (like NYX Bare With Me Concealer Serum) under your eyes and on any spots, blending softly with your fingers. 
  • Step 4: Add warmth with a bronzer (such as Benefit Hoola Lite) swept lightly across your forehead, cheekbones, and jawline using a fluffy brush. 
  • Step 5: Apply a cream blush (like Burt’s Bees Blush Basin) to your cheekbones, blending upward for a fresh flush. 
  • Step 6: Tap a liquid highlighter (e.g., Wet n Wild Megaglo Liquid Highlighter) onto your cheekbones, brow bones, and nose tip, blending for a subtle glow. 
  • Step 7: Use a tinted lip balm or gloss and a quick swipe of mascara.
  • Step 8 Finish with a setting spray—done in minutes, glowing all day!

Using Setting Spray to Lock in Your Glowy Makeup for a Natural Look

Using a setting spray is a game-changer for locking in your glowy makeup while keeping it natural and radiant all day. After applying your foundation, concealer, blush, bronzer, and highlighter, reach for a hydrating setting spray like NYX Dewy Finish Setting Spray or Pixi Glow Mist—lightly mist it over your face in a “T” and “X” motion, holding the bottle about 8-10 inches away. This not only fuses the layers for a seamless, skin-like finish but also adds an extra boost of moisture, enhancing that lit-from-within look without stickiness.

Choose a formula with ingredients like glycerin or aloe to maintain hydration, avoiding matte or alcohol-heavy sprays that can dull your glow. Let it dry naturally (no fanning!), and your makeup will stay fresh and luminous, effortlessly carrying you through the day with a natural, dewy vibe intact.

Integrating SPF into Your Makeup Routine

Integrating SPF into your makeup routine is a seamless way to protect your skin while maintaining that glowy vibe. Start with a lightweight, broad-spectrum SPF moisturizer (like Neutrogena Hydro Boost Water Gel SPF 25) as your base layer after cleansing—it hydrates and shields without clogging pores. For added coverage, swap standalone sunscreen for a tinted moisturizer or foundation with built-in SPF, such as BareMinerals Complexion Rescue Tinted Hydrating Gel Cream SPF 30, applying it with a damp sponge for a natural finish. 

If you prefer separate products, layer a non-greasy SPF (e.g., Supergoop! Unseen Sunscreen SPF 40) under your foundation—it doubles as a smooth, grippy primer. Reapply throughout the day with an SPF-infused setting spray (like Coola Makeup Setting Spray SPF 30) to refresh your glow and boost protection without disturbing your look. This way, you’re safeguarded from UV damage while keeping that radiant complexion intact.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a glowing makeup look, and how does it differ from a matte look?

A glowing makeup look is all about achieving a dewy, radiant complexion that mimics a healthy, natural glow. It emphasizes light-reflecting elements to give the skin a luminous appearance. This is in contrast to a matte look, which aims to minimize shine and create a more flat, velvety finish. The glowing look often involves the use of products that contain shimmer or glowy elements, while matte products are designed to absorb excess oil.

How can I achieve glowing makeup without looking oily and shiny?

To achieve glowing makeup without looking oily, it’s essential to balance hydration with oil control. Start with a good skincare and makeup routine, using a lightweight moisturizer that hydrates without making your skin look greasy.
